WILLIAM HONE
English compiler, writer and bookseller
(1779 - 1842)

Here quench your thirst, and mark in me
  An emblem of true charity;
    Who, while my bounty I bestow,
      Am neither seen, nor heard to flow.
      - [Water]

Mr. Howel Walsh, in a corporation case tried at the Tralee assizes, observed that a corporation cannot blush. It was a body, it was true; had certainly a head--a new one very year--an annual acquisition of intelligence in every new lord mayor. Arms he supposed it had, and very long ones too, for it could reach at anything. Legs, of course, when it made such long strides. A throat to swallow the rights of the community, and a stomach to digest them. But who ever yet discovered, in the anatomy of any corporation, either bowels or a heart?
      - Table-Book [Business]
